NVD · uneditedCoolify is an open-source and self-hostable tool for managing servers, applications, and databases. Prior to version 4.0.0-beta.361, the missing authorization allows any authenticated user to fetch the details page for any GitHub / GitLab configuration on a Coolify instance by only knowing the UUID of the model. This exposes the "client id", "client secret" and "webhook secret." Version 4.0.0-beta.361 fixes this issue.

dbcve analysis · high confidenceMissing authorization check in Coolify allows any authenticated user to access GitHub/GitLab configuration details by knowing the UUID, exposing sensitive credentials (client ID, client secret, webhook secret). This is an Insecure Direct Object Reference (IDOR) vulnerability.

Upgrade to Coolify version 4.0.0-beta.361 or later which adds proper authorization checks to prevent unauthorized access to GitHub/GitLab configuration details.
4.0.0-beta.361 or later
- Backup your current Coolify instance and database before upgrading
- Upgrade Coolify to version 4.0.0-beta.361 or later
- Verify the upgrade was successful by logging into the Coolify dashboard
- After upgrade, rotate any GitHub/GitLab credentials that may have been exposed through this vulnerability
